Reality Synthesizer GPU Professionally Reballed by PSRReality Synthesizer GPU Professionally Reballed by PSR, Inc. Now Reballing the Sony PS3 RSX-GPU - The Sony PS3 has several issues that are directly related to the Reality Synthesizer, Graphics Processing Unit commonly referred to as the RSX chip or the GPU. The most common of many problems is the YLOD, Red Blinking light, No video and Video Pixilation. The only repair solution is to replace or ReBall the RSX-GPU. The most common of the many...

Intel Core i7 975 Extreme – World’s Fastest – ReviewedIntel's Core i7 975 Extreme Edition reviewed, crowned world's fastest desktop processor: Surprise, Intel's top of the line 3.33GHz Core i7 975 Extreme Edition is fast. In fact, based on the reviews by Hot Hardware and PC Perspective, among others, this quad-core proc is the fastest desktop processor ever. While it's only 4-5% faster across the board than Intel's previous champ, the Core i7 965, world's fastest is world's fastest, right...
